Voice of THE Child
A Voice of the Child report is one way to give children a chance to be heard in family law proceedings. It’s a written report prepared by a Licensed Psychologist who interviews the child, and is typically ordered by a judge. These reports share information about a child’s views and preferences around custody, access, and visitation, giving the child space to communicate their thoughts and feelings.
